A FAMILLE ROSE SNUFF BOTTLE
QIANLONG SEAL MARK, 20TH CENTURY

Of elegant flattened pear shape, one side enamelled with insects hovering above roses issuing from rockwork, the reverse with delicate irises and lingzhi fungus, the base with key-pattern, stopper
